Judy Ann (Schroeder) Bemmels, 76, of Palm Coast, Florida, passed away peacefully on March 7, 2026.

Born in Fairfax, Minnesota, Judy grew up surrounded by family and small-town values that remained important to her during life.  Throughout her life, she and her family made homes in Minnesota, Wisconsin, and Florida, each place bringing new friendships, meaningful connections, and treasured memories that stayed with her always. Yet through every move and every chapter, her one true constant home was always with her husband, Bob.

Judy married her high school sweetheart, Robert “Bob” Bemmels, on March 28, 1967. Together they shared a life rooted in love and partnership while raising their three children, Lynnae, Robert Jr., and Wade. As the years passed, their family grew to include nine grandchildren and two great-grandchildren, all of whom were a constant source of pride and joy for Judy.

A loving mother, grandmother, sister and friend, Judy found happiness in life’s simple moments. She valued time spent with those she loved—whether sharing “Pepsi breaks” with her dear friend Carleen, supporting her children in all their activities, working at the University bookstore, or enjoying life outdoors surrounded by family. She especially cherished spending time with her grandchildren; coloring, doing puzzles, crafts, and baking. Judy loved telling stories about her “adventures with Bob” and taking motorcycle trips with Bob, Lynnae, and close friends Paul and Arlyss.

Judy is survived by her children, Lynnae, Robert Jr. (Danielle), and Wade (Kacie); nine grandchildren: Heather, Da’Lynn, Darrell, Brielle, Bella, Breckin, Ryder, Chase, and Alexa; and two great-grandchildren, Tahlia and Andre.

She was preceded in death by her husband, Bob; her parents, Leroy and Marcella; her brother, Roger; and sister, Barb.

Judy will be remembered for her gentle kindness, devotion to family, and ability to find joy in the everyday.  A Celebration of Life will be held June 6, 2026 at the Best Western in New Ulm, Minnesota.  The family welcomes friends and family to gather there as we share memories and honor Judy from 3:00-7:00 pm with a service at 4:00 pm.
